The Housing Growth and Regeneration team have agreed with Thirteen Group to extend the option agreement dates on 2 sites (Main Avenue and Highmoor Lane) which are parcelled in the RP Clusters Programme. The extension is required due to delays faced to the programme and to allow for contingency period.

This decision is in the best interests to support the decision which was made at Cabinet to dispose the RP clusters sites to Thirteen Group to bring forward high quality, affordable and sustainable homes on five sites across the district. The Council’s preferred partner is Thirteen Group, who are a strategic partner of Homes England, as part of Home’s England’s programme which supports registered providers (housing associations) to deliver more affordable homes. Thirteen Group were appointed by the Council following a competitive land sale exercise.
